Solar energy storage can be broken into three general categories: battery, thermal, and mechanical. Let’s take a quick look at each.

Storing this surplus energy is essential to getting the most out of any solar panel system, and can result in cost-savings, more efficient energy grids, and decreased fossil fuel emissions.

There’s no silver bullet solution for solar energy storage. Solar energy storage solutions depend on your requirements and available resources. Let’s look at some common solar.

Using Aurora’s battery storage functionality, solar installers can.Solar battery systems work by storing excess electricity generated during the day and releasing it when needed, such as at night or during outages. Here’s a simplified flow: Daytime: Solar panels power the home and charge the battery. Nighttime / Cloudy Days: The battery discharges stored power.
